Ramblers Rest RV Campground
Overview
Ramblers Rest RV Campground offers a classic Florida camping experience nestled along the banks of the Myakka River. As a well-established resort in the Thousand Trails network, it provides a scenic retreat where towering oak trees and Spanish moss create a peaceful, shaded atmosphere. This destination successfully balances the tranquility of nature with the comforts of a full-service RV resort, making it a popular choice for seasonal visitors and travelers looking for an authentic Florida landscape near the Gulf Coast.
Location & Surroundings
The campground is situated in Venice, Florida, uniquely positioned to provide both riverfront beauty and convenient proximity to the ocean. The scenic Myakka River serves as the park's centerpiece, offering a quiet waterway for paddling and wildlife viewing right from the property. While the park feels secluded and immersed in nature, it is only a short drive from the historic architecture and boutique shopping found in downtown Venice, offering the best of both worlds for those who enjoy both wilderness and urban amenities.
Amenities & Park Features
Visitors can enjoy a wide array of recreational facilities designed for both relaxation and active play. The park features a large heated swimming pool and a sun deck, perfect for cooling off throughout the year. For those who enjoy community sports, there are courts for pickleball and shuffleboard, as well as a miniature golf course for family fun. The park also provides a private boat ramp and a fishing pier, giving guests direct access to the river for fishing adventures or afternoon boat rides.
Nearby Attractions & Things to Do
Beyond the park gates, the Venice area is famous for its unique coastal activities and natural wonders. A short trip to Caspersen Beach allows visitors to hunt for prehistoric shark teeth, a popular local tradition. Cyclists and hikers will enjoy the Legacy Trail, a paved path that winds through beautiful Florida scenery. For a deeper dive into the wild, the nearby Myakka River State Park offers expansive vistas, canopy walks, and airboat tours through one of the state's most diverse and preserved ecosystems.

Chuck Camp
We stayed here for 35 days in our 40 ft. Motorhome. Site was level gravel. Full hook up. The staff was very friendly and accommodating. The facilities were extremely clean and well kept. Grounds were maintained amd in excellent shape. They do have concrete pads at some sites.
Barb Clark
We just spent two weeks with our Rv at Ramblers Rest. It was great. Staff was so nice and informative. Check-in was a breese. The pool area was so nice and clean. The sites were very spacious ours was shaded with beautiful trees. The fishing off the dock was great. The laundry room was the best I have used on the road. The bathroom/ shower are suites. So shower toilet sink all behind one door. Then there was the dog park. Our dogs loved going to the dog park to run and play. We cannot wait to come back. The only down side which is no ones fault is the road construction going to the resort. Trying to get out of there during rush hour was very difficult. Again not their fault. Hopefully by next visit it will be completed. Photo from dock on the river.

Juan Sanchez
This mobile home/RV hybrid park tends to flood rather easily when it rains. The pool and amenities are very nice, but the sites need TLC. The layout is a circle, so driving or even walking through the park is cumbersome specialy after it rains. Entry into the park is on River Road which is still under construction for almost 5 years or so, this makes it tricky to get in and out of the park.
